At most major airlines the flight attendants are paid the same on international flights as they are paid for domestic flights. The only increase is in per diem and even that is only about twenty to thirty cents more each hour.

Between 20 and 22 dollarsan hr. however that's flight time, which means they only get paid while they are flying and not when they are on ground.
Flight attendants make an average salary of starting at $15,000.00 annually up to as much as $50,000.00 USD for very senior flight attendants with At least 25-30 years of service. Rates of pay can vary a great deal between airlines. Also, they usually receive health and retirement benefits, and typically pass privileges on their own airline and others with which they have "open cabin" for flight attendants or other space available agreements for flight attendants and designated pass recipients. The amount of travel and destinations depend upon the type of carrier one works with. Some airlines only travel within the country of origin, while others fly internationally.
